I briefly experimented with Fold after reading the Release Notes. Those
could include a link to https://code.jsoftware.com/wiki/Vocabulary/fcap,
which I found through a web search.

I tried to run the Trajectory example from that page and got a value
error. Where? A visual look at the script revealed a susceptible
culprit: mean. Added require 'stats/base' and it ran.

While trying the Trajectory, I ran the script with the debugger. [The
debugger did not fail, great!] The value error on mean was not obvious.
The stack is given as:
value error
Fold_j_[40] 13!:8]13!:11''[FoldZv_j_=:fzv
trajectory[0] u F: v y

This Trajectory example is a simple case. I suspect that errors in more
complex cases may not be easy to analyze.
